当前位置: 技术问答>linux和unix
想在游戏服务器上面发展求指导
来源: 互联网 发布时间:2017-03-07
本文导语: 小菜是今年毕业的应届生,目前在一家网页游戏公司做Erlang(也是服务器开发语言,类似java运行方式,但是没有变量)开发,小菜在大学期间对c++比较感兴趣所以花在c++的事件比较多,因为网游的服务器应都用unix...
小菜是今年毕业的应届生,目前在一家网页游戏公司做Erlang(也是服务器开发语言,类似java运行方式,但是没有变量)开发,小菜在大学期间对c++比较感兴趣所以花在c++的事件比较多,因为网游的服务器应都用unix或 unix like所以着重学了 unix环境高级编程,并且近期最近准备看 unix网络编程。但是事实就这样我找了一份erlang开发的工作,做网页游戏的服务端,最初接触这门语言感觉面向并发的编程还是蛮有趣的,并且想着以后能够深入下去。
但关键是,我又放不下c++,所以想在工作之余学下c++是怎么做游戏服务器的,希望在csdn中得到大神的指导,小菜不经感激!
指导方面最好写上:需要的知识 对应要看什么书 有什么东西可以拿来练手 有什么开源的项目适合提高看
最后附上关于erlang的介绍:http://baike.baidu.com/view/765701.htm
但关键是,我又放不下c++,所以想在工作之余学下c++是怎么做游戏服务器的,希望在csdn中得到大神的指导,小菜不经感激!
指导方面最好写上:需要的知识 对应要看什么书 有什么东西可以拿来练手 有什么开源的项目适合提高看
最后附上关于erlang的介绍:http://baike.baidu.com/view/765701.htm
|
游戏有前途啊。
暴利行业~~
暴利行业~~
|
做服务端主要是C,你说的C++只能说是做游戏时候技术选型最终定在C++上的比较多。
你都工作了,估计学习时间很少,考虑清楚是不是要在Erlang方面深入下去(该语言很受关注)。
或者是压榨自己的业余时间,学习APUE,UNP等基础开发能力,说实话这些东西想做好做牛并不简单,像我而言,我看了很多开源代码,APUE,UNP已经熟到不用看书了,TCP/IP详解里的各种协议都像看小说一样轻松了,写C服务端程序都几乎不用动多少脑子了(尤其是学习模仿了很多开源代码的实现架构与解耦合手段),写的代码质量高且易扩展,而且PHP网站前后端我都能写了,还是一个PHP高手,PYTHON我现在写起来也没问题了,就是库用的不太熟。
你要觉得我这么一个程度你有信心在业余时间达到的话,just do it,因为linux c服务端开发真的很有帮助,非常利于向上层应用发展。
你都工作了,估计学习时间很少,考虑清楚是不是要在Erlang方面深入下去(该语言很受关注)。
或者是压榨自己的业余时间,学习APUE,UNP等基础开发能力,说实话这些东西想做好做牛并不简单,像我而言,我看了很多开源代码,APUE,UNP已经熟到不用看书了,TCP/IP详解里的各种协议都像看小说一样轻松了,写C服务端程序都几乎不用动多少脑子了(尤其是学习模仿了很多开源代码的实现架构与解耦合手段),写的代码质量高且易扩展,而且PHP网站前后端我都能写了,还是一个PHP高手,PYTHON我现在写起来也没问题了,就是库用的不太熟。
你要觉得我这么一个程度你有信心在业余时间达到的话,just do it,因为linux c服务端开发真的很有帮助,非常利于向上层应用发展。